What makes French Bulldogs so expensive?

French Bulldogs were selectively bred and so their bodies are not well suited to reproducing Females have a narrow pelvis but their puppies have large heads so veterinary help is required. Frenchies also struggle conceiving naturally, so most breeders rely on artificial insemination, which is an expensive process.

What are isabella Frenchies?

Isabella French Bulldogs are considered the rarest in the Frenchie world Similarly to lilac Frenchies, they are the combination of blue and chocolate but they have a much more

unique greyish liver coat color

. Isabella Frenchies are extremely hard to come by, which makes them incredibly valuable for breeding purposes.

What is a tri Frenchie?

French Bulldog triple carrier meaning Breeders call Frenchies triple carriers if they carry 3 of the rare color DNA genes Breeders then say that by mating a triple carrier female with a triple carrier male, they can guarantee that the offspring will be one of the “rare” colors.

What are

black frenchies

called?

Black and Tan French Bulldog is a solid black Frenchie with tan points. Tan points are markings that usually appear in a shape of “eyebrows”, patches on the sides of the cheeks, paws and occasionally on the tail as well.

What is a lilac French Bulldog?

Lilac French bulldog has a noticeable lilac hue of the coat. It occurs due to the same dilution gene that causes a blue hue of hair. If you would ask us to describe this coat color, we can say it a pale greyish-brown coat This type of color occurs spontaneously when a dog is a carrier of a recessive gene.
